Ingredients

  • pounds bacon 
  • 0.5 cup celery chopped
  • 29 ounce chicken broth canned
  • 10.8 ounce cream of chicken soup canned
  • 10.8 ounce cream of mushroom soup canned
  • 0.5 cup bell pepper green chopped
  • 0.5 cup onion chopped
  • 3.5 cups water 
  • cup rice wild uncooked

Equipment

  • frying pan
  • sauce pan

Directions

  1. In a small sauce pan, cook rice with two cups of water until tender; set aside. Fry the bacon until crisp.
  2. Drain, but reserve 5 tablespoons of the grease. Crumble bacon and set aside.
  3. Fry the onions, celery and green peppers in the bacon grease until the onions are translucent.
  4. Transfer the vegetables, rice and crumbled bacon to a 5 quart pan. Stir in the mushroom and chicken soups, chicken broth and remaining 3 1/2 cups of water. Simmer over medium heat for one hour to blend all of the flavors.
